Description
Stoic Wisdom: Ancient Lessons for Modern Resilience offers practical guidance on finding calm and coping with life's challenges. Drawing on the wisdom of ancient Stoics, Nancy Sherman presents a modern approach to living well, focusing on the importance of close relationships and resilience. By examining our beliefs and perceptions, we can correct distortions and build goodness through our connections with others. This book provides nine lessons that combine ancient pithy quotes with contemporary ethics and psychology, making it a valuable resource for navigating 21st-century concerns such as stress, burnout, and social justice. Sherman's Stoic Wisdom is a field manual for the art of living well, providing a unique perspective on how to cultivate resilience and goodness in our daily lives.
